This view isolates hedge funds from the broader institutional ownership shown on the Institutional tab. A pension fund tracking an index may have no view on a stock; when a hedge fund builds or exits a position, that decision can carry information. This page measures those changes. Positions as of June 30, 2026.
Based on quarterly 13F long-equity filings. Changes compare reported quarter-end positions; filings can be reported up to 45 days later and do not represent a fund's complete exposure.
